Picture Point
AI-suggested draft · review before you go
No permit or access details on file for this trail — check with the local land manager before you go.
Picture Point offers a moderate 8.94-mile round trip with nearly 2,500 feet of elevation gain, making it an excellent choice for hikers seeking alpine views and a solid workout. The trail climbs steadily through Montana terrain, rewarding hikers with panoramic vistas from the summit point. This is a classic Montana day hike that combines accessible distance with meaningful elevation challenge.
